Match.com’s last Annual Singles in the us research got a review of how principles of online dating etiquette have actually altered now that were trapped during the hip (or wallet or palm) with this smartphones. Whitney Casey, a Match.com commitment specialist, implies watching here seven perform’s and don’ts in relation to the cellular and internet dating decorum:
- understand thy self(ie). Most men report adoring any type of pictures sent their method, whether nice or gorgeous, but most ladies state gorgeous photos are a phone faux pas. 75% of women position juicy images as his or her #1 foul, while 76% of males say it’s their unique #1 type telephone foreplay.
- Save the jargon. Emoticons tend to be a-ok, but abbreviations tend to be another story. Steer clear of slang that needs a Google find decoding.
- Text time is every thing. Just like the fantastic Selfie Debate, women and men disagree significantly throughout the perfect time for texting. 63% of women say they enjoy texting during work several hours, but guys would like to stay focused on their unique tasks from 9-5. “Texting during work hrs” placed 2nd for the top three cellphone fouls for men.
- Be trained in text tempo. Cool your own jets. Men and women dislike it when you are as well fast in the text draw. Giving a second book before obtaining a reply is an important no-no for all. Almost 60per cent of men state it really is their unique #1 telephone foul, while females position it inside their leading three.
- Cast a broad net. The greater amount of times, the merrier! 72per cent of females state it’s all right to casually date multiple individual on the other hand and 60% of men agree.
- Save the crisis for the mama. 84per cent of women and 80per cent of men believe using social media to air psychological drama or chronicle personal life details which are also personal is an enormous switch off.
